Submission Guidelines and Rules
To maintain the quality and consistency of content on Pitchworx, please adhere to the following guidelines:
- Originality: All submissions must be 100% original content.
- Word Count: Articles should be between 1,500 to 2,500 words.
- Quality: Content must be well-researched, informative, and provide genuine value.
- Visual Content: Include at least 2-3 high-quality, copyright-free images.
- Links: You may include 1-2 relevant dofollow links to your own website or portfolio.
What We Don’t Accept:
Promotional content, previously published articles, unedited AI-generated content, thin content, or offensive material.
Submission Process
- Step 1: Review our content to understand our style and audience.
- Step 2: Choose a topic or pitch your own unique idea.
- Step 3: Send your pitch (200-300 word outline) to our editorial team.
- Step 4: Wait for approval before writing the full article (response within 5-7 business days).
- Step 5: Write your article following our guidelines.
- Step 6: Submit your completed article with author bio and images at “write for us“.
- Step 7: Our editorial team will review and may request revisions.
- Step 8: Once approved, your article will be scheduled for publication.
Author Bio Requirements
Include a brief bio (50-100 words) with your name, professional title, expertise, one link to your website or portfolio, and optional social media handles.
